> Quote from the first paragraph of the FAQ:
> 
> The Valvoline VR1 Racing and other racing oils <https://www.valvoline.com/our-products/motor-oil> not intended for passenger vehicles contain additional additives for increased horsepower and reduced friction on metal parts, provide extra wear protection for high compression/higher horsepower engines, and include fewer detergents than regular conventional motor oils.
> 
> So, that answers that question. If you change your oil frequently, it probably isn?t a problem, though.
> 
> I have used racing oil in the transmission, however, because reduced friction and wear protection are relevant concepts, and detergent is pointless (since no combustion blow-by).

> I don't want to quibble, but I think ?less than expected? or ?insufficient? are also perfectly valid meanings. If I lack money to pay my bills, that doesn?t mean I have absolutely zero money to my name. I just don't have enough.
> 
> I would say that the ?not intended for passenger vehicles? part of the quote justifies my ?insufficient? assumption. What else could it be referring to? ?Too much? anti-friction or anti-wear? Hardly.
> 
> Again, I wasn?t actually criiticizing the idea of using this oil. Lower level of detergent isn?t an engine-killer, if you change the oil regularly. I just know that a lot of people drive their vintage cars infrequently and irregularly, and may not change the oil all that often, so I would hesitate to recommend it as the first option, since there are other alternatives available.
